Re: Sony A99


What you get over the D600:

Contrast Detect AF accuracy

Fully Articulated Screen (I can\'t have a camera without at least a tilt any more)

In Body Image Stabilization (Wish my NEX had this)

Latest EVF (It\'s like having Live View on constantly which is great for magnification and focus accuracy)

Focus Peaking (Crucial for very fast manual focus when using fast manual glass)

Probably better Grip (The A77 grip is Amazing)

Zeiss AF Glass (Including the forthcoming Zeiss SSM 50mm F1.4 early 2013)

Preset AF zones (not an action shooter so I don\'t really care)

Probably better Video (I don\'t care)

Dual Slot recording (Critical when you\'re on a high stakes shoot and need backups!!)

Built in GPS (If you travel a lot, this is pretty handy)



What you Lose to the D600:

Probably about .5T stops on every lens you use

Some size

Not as comprehensive set of lenses and aftermarket

You can\'t use the great set of ZF.2 glass with auto-aperture


IMO, probably worth the extra $700 for the A99 if you don\'t have a big collection of Nikon AF-S lenses already.
